Understanding the Administrative Burden
Administrative work in music academies includes a wide range of tasks. From enrolling students and assigning teachers to managing timetables and handling cancellations, every small activity adds up.
Some common challenges include:
- Manual scheduling conflicts
- Delayed communication with students and parents
- Tracking payments and overdue invoices
- Maintaining student records
- Coordinating between multiple teachers
When handled manually, these tasks can consume hours every day. As the academy grows, the workload increases exponentially, making it difficult to maintain consistency and quality.

Simplifying Scheduling and Class Management
Scheduling is often one of the most complex aspects of running a music academy. With multiple teachers, varying student availability, and different class formats, managing schedules manually can lead to confusion.
Using structured systems, academies can:
- View all classes in a single calendar
- Avoid overlapping schedules
- Reschedule classes easily
- Track teacher availability
This level of organization ensures that both teachers and students stay informed, reducing last-minute disruptions.

Managing Payments Without Stress
Handling payments manually often leads to delays and inconsistencies. Keeping track of who has paid, who hasn’t, and when invoices are due can be overwhelming.
Digital systems simplify financial management by:
- Generating invoices automatically
- Sending payment reminders
- Allowing online payment options
- Tracking payment history
This not only reduces administrative workload but also improves cash flow and transparency.
